<meter id="pryje"><nav id="pryje"><delect id="pryje"></delect></nav></meter>
          <label id="pryje"></label>

          新聞中心

          EEPW首頁 > 嵌入式系統 > 新品快遞 > Microchip 發布PIC16F13145系列MCU,促進可定制邏輯的新發展

          Microchip 發布PIC16F13145系列MCU,促進可定制邏輯的新發展

          —— 新型可配置邏輯模塊(CLB)提供量身定制的硬件解決方案,有助于消除對外部邏輯元件的需求
          作者:時間:2024-01-25來源:電子產品世界收藏

          為了滿足嵌入式應用日益增長的定制化需求, Technology Inc.(微芯科技公司)推出PIC16F13145系列單片機(),提供量身定制的硬件解決方案。該系列配備了全新的獨立于內核的外設(CIP),即可配置邏輯塊模塊,可直接在內創建基于硬件的定制組合邏輯功能。由于集成到MCU,CLB使設計人員能夠優化嵌入式控制系統的速度和響應時間,無需外部邏輯元件,從而降低了物料清單(BOM)成本和功耗。圖形接口工具可幫助使用CLB綜合定制邏輯設計,進一步簡化了流程。PIC16F13145系列專為利用定制協議、任務排序或 I/O 控制來管理工業和汽車領域實時控制系統的應用而設計。

          本文引用地址:http://www.ex-cimer.com/article/202401/455106.htm

          image.png

          負責8位單片機業務部的副總裁Greg Robinson 表示:“可配置邏輯單元 CLC)模塊集成到 MCU 中已有十多年歷史,新發布的CLB 模塊是我們產品發展的新階段,使該系列MCU能夠用于通常屬于獨立可編程邏輯器件領域的應用。當今市場上很少有單芯片解決方案能像PIC16F131系列MCU那樣解決嵌入式工程師的設計難題。新型MCU可處理定制邏輯功能,最大限度地降低功耗,簡化設計,并能適應不斷變化的設計要求?!?/span>

           

          由于CLB的運行不依賴于CPU的時鐘速度,因此能改善系統的延遲,并提供低功耗解決方案。CLB可用于在CPU休眠模式下做出邏輯決策,從而進一步降低功耗和軟件依賴性。PIC16F13145 MCU還包括一個具有內置計算功能的快速10位模數轉換器(ADC)、一個8位數模轉換器 DAC)、快速比較器、8位和16位定時器以及串行通信模塊(I2CSPI),從而可以在沒有CPU的情況下執行許多系統級任務。該系列將提供從8引腳到20引腳的各種封裝。

           

          開發工具

          PIC16F13145 系列 MCU得到MPLAB? 代碼配置器(MCC)支持 ,這是MPLAB X IDE中一個免費軟件插件,提供了一個基于GUI的簡便接口,用于配置器件和板載外設(包括 CLB)。該接口可為高級用戶提供使用硬件描述語言(HDL)的選項,通過原理圖設計所需的定制邏輯,從而縮短開發時間。新的合成器有兩種選擇:集成到MCC,以及在線方式logic.microchip.com。PIC16F131 Curiosity Nano 評估工具包為使用 PIC16F131 系列進行設計提供全面支持,可協調實現無縫嵌入式開發體驗,縮短產品上市時間。

          image.png

          供貨與定價

          PIC16F131 MCU每件售價0.47 美元,10,000件起售。如需了解更多信息或購買。

          image.png



          評論


          相關推薦

          技術專區

          關閉
          看屁屁www成人影院,亚洲人妻成人图片,亚洲精品成人午夜在线,日韩在线 欧美成人 (function(){ var bp = document.createElement('script'); var curProtocol = window.location.protocol.split(':')[0]; if (curProtocol === 'https') { bp.src = 'https://zz.bdstatic.com/linksubmit/push.js'; } else { bp.src = 'http://push.zhanzhang.baidu.com/push.js'; } var s = document.getElementsByTagName("script")[0]; s.parentNode.insertBefore(bp, s); })();